Advanced Research and Invention Agency: Finance

Question for Department for Business, Energy and Industrial Strategy

UIN 180974, tabled on 14 April 2021

To ask the Secretary of State for Business, Energy and Industrial Strategy, what estimate he has made of the proportion of the science budget that will be allocated to the Advanced Research and Invention Agency in each remaining year of the 2019 Parliament.

Answered on

19 April 2021

ARIA’s budget commitment of £800m up to 2024/25 is expected to represent less than 2% of the Government’s current total annual R&D investment over the same period.

Named day
Named day questions only occur in the House of Commons. The MP tabling the question specifies the date on which they should receive an answer. MPs may not table more than five named day questions on a single day.
